Netbackup 6 MP4 on Windows Master possible gotcha with NBU notifications

Tim_Wilkinson
Level 4
Hi,

I thought I'd mention this since other people are bound to have this issue.
I'd noticed that no email notifications or catalog DR emails had been sent out after applying MP4 onto a Windows Master (Server 2003, SP1).
It turns out that a file called nbmail in the bin dir had been overwritten; what had actually caused the NBU emails to stop was the fact that the new file was just a file of commented out lines (and therefore did nothing).
You can probably uncomment out the required lines but I just replaced it with the pre-MP4 file (had MP3 previously).

Same thing happens with your backup_exit_notify scripts......if you're using these for SOX compliance (as we were), be VERY careful and test very thoroughly to make sure any functionality you added in yourself doesn't get overwritten!

Noticed today that the same thing happens with NBU 5.1 after applying MP6.
The nbmail.cmd file is replaced (thus deactivated).

Yep, that happens every time you apply a MP. You can find your original one in the X:\Program Files\VERITAS\Patch\NB_60_4_M\ directory, called nbmail.cmd943 (the numbers may be different for you).
